In the previous papers of this Journal no. 22 (March 2014), no. 31 (March 2018), and no. 41 (March 2021), the author discussed the development of bilateral relations between Japan and Vietnam from 2002 to 2013, from 2014 to 2015, and from 2016 to 2017 respectively.
Following them, the First Section of this paper describes the major events in 2018, including President Tran Dai Quang’s state visit to Japan as well as various events commemorating the 45th anniversary of diplomatic relations between the two countries. In the Second Section, the author describes the major events in 2019, including PM Nguyen Xuan Phuc’s visit to Japan to attend the G20 Osaka Summit. In the Third Section, the author describes various contacts between the two nations during the COVID-19 pandemic.
